ABOUT THE PROGRAM: Roots to Recovery
Roots to Recovery: A Holistic Approach to Substance Use Treatment (R2R) is an intermediate 24/7 residential treatment for men in need of a structured environment to continue building upon their recovery skills. There are 14 beds and it is a 90 day maximum intermediate (3.5) residential substance abuse treatment are referred from intensive treatment programs emergency room staff and/or detox programs. Clients with co-occurring disorders and on Methadone maintenance are accepted.
